Sketchbook 1, 1899

This file contains a bound sketchbook containing drawings, colour sketches and notes of architectural ornaments, chairs and other furniture, doors, windows, and building exteriors. Includes photos of furniture and architectural decor clipped from catalogues, and some drawings on loose tracing paper tucked into the volume.

Sketchbook 2, 1899

This file consists of a bound sketchbook containing notes, drawings and some colour sketches of churches, residences, architectural ornaments, tile and textile ornaments, and some birds and sculptures. Includes some photos pasted in, and some drawings on loose tracing paper tucked into the volume.

Italian Drawings of P.E. Nobbs

File consists of measured drawings: Coloured marble, Palazzo Dario, Grand Canal, Venice (1) --Porta San Zeno, Verona (2) --Pal Davanzati, Florence (1) --Marble mosaic floor, St. Mark's, Venice (1) --Sant' Anastasia, Verona (1).

Student Drawings (Ironwork) of P.E. Nobbs

File consists primarily of drawings of ironwork, including 22 measured drawings: --Wrought iron gate, Chelmsford (1) --Wrought iron railings and gate, Greeston Stair, Lincoln (2) --Donibristle, Fife (1) --Baroque gate, Rennes, Brittany (2) --Wrought iron hinge by Bodley, St. Pauls Burton (1) --Unidentified wrought iron detail (1) --Staircase panel, Caroline Park, Granton (2) --Wrought iron, Terrington, St. Clements, Norfolk (2) --Wrought iron choir stalls, St. Paul's (2) --Ely (1) --Wrought iron screen and hinges, Lincoln Cathedral (3) --Early 13th century wrought iron hinge, Market Deeping (1) --Wrought iron gates, Ruspoli Palace, Siena (1) --Sempringham (1) --Private entrance to churchyard, Belton House, Lines (1). Also includes 2 development drawings: --Proposed new gates, St. Annes Soho (1) --Fireplace Dog (1).

Student Prize and Competition Drawings of P.E. Nobbs

File consists of presentation drawings: --Design for an isolated clock tower and belfry (1899) [Winning submission for The Prize 1900] (3) --Decorations for hall and stair, Coleshill, Berks. Prescribed in the Owen Jones Studentship 1901 (2) --Design for a swimming bath for men [Submitted for Soane Medallion 1901-1902] (1) Design for the mosaic decoration of Sta. Fosca at Torcello (1902) [Winning submission for Owen Jones Studentship 1903] (3) --Design for a town church [Submitted for Soane Medallion 1902-1903] (1) --Untitled drawing for stained glass windows depicting six male saints (1).

Student Drawings of P.E. Nobbs

File consists of 35 measured drawings: --Unidentified details of contours (1) --Elevations, sections and plans of St. Athernase, Leuchars, Fife (5) --Tomb of children of Charles VIII, Museum of Science and Art, Edinburgh (1) --Cornice of stone chimneypiece, Petinelli Palace, Padua (1) --Vaulting over entrance to Quadrangle, University of Edinburgh (1) --Elevations, section, plan and details of Whitekirk, Haddingtonshire and St. Mary, Haddington (3) --Elevations, section, plan and details of Register House, Edinburgh (2) --Elevations, sections and plan at south aisle, Holyrood Chapel (4) --Doorway of Chapter House, Lincoln Cathedral (2) --Stalls in Southwold Church, Suffolk (3) --Unidentified elevation and plans of clock tower (1) --Cast of sarcophagus of Carlo Marsuppini, Museum of Science and Art, Edinburgh (1) --Foliage, Beverley [Minster] (1) --Details of Wayside Chapel, Houghton Le Dale, Norfolk (3) --Unidentified foliated freize, Museum of Science and Art, Edinburgh (1) --French 13th-century foliated capitals (4) --Soffit of window in hall, Hengrave Hall (1)

House for C.W. Colby

File consists of architectural drawings for urban house (detached, basement, 2 floors, attic, 5 bedrooms); brick; wall bearing. File includes 1 presentation drawing (exterior perspective, floor plans), 3 record drawings (floor plans, elevations, section), and 4 photographs (1 plan, 1 finished exterior, 3 finished interiors).

Proposal of House for E. Rutherford

File consists of architectural drawings for urban house (detached, basement, 2 floors, attic, 5 bedrooms); wood; roughcast; wall bearing. Includes 1 presentation drawing (ground and bedroom floor plans, north, south and west elevations), 9 development drawings (floor plans, elevations, section), and 1 record drawing (floor plans, elevations).
